The recommended temperature range for roasting coffee beans is between 370-540°F (190-280°C). Unfortunately, the maximum temperature of most home air fryers is around 450°F (232°C). The beans roast just fine at 450°F, but it's also the reason you may not be able to get the darkest roasts from an air fryer.

Place 1 to 4 cups of fresh green beans into the basket. (I recommend Arabica.) Place the basket into the air fryer. Roast for about 9 to 11 minutes. (More about the roasting times below.) When roasting a full basket, then open the lead at the 5-6 minute mark, stir the beans so that they roast more evenly.

Temperature: The optimal temperature for roasting coffee beans in an air fryer is between 400-450°F (204-232°C). Consider that some air fryers have a temperature limit, so check the manufacturer's instructions. Timing: The roasting process can take between 8 and 20 minutes, depending on the desired roast level.
